Active Ingredient – Tadalafil

The core active compound in Vidalista 40 is Tadalafil, which is chemically identical to the ingredient found in Cialis. Tadalafil works by inhibiting the PDE5 enzyme, allowing increased blood flow to the corpus cavernosum. The standard 40 mg dosage implies that each tablet contains 40 milligrams of Tadalafil, making it a moderate-to-high dose intended for those with more persistent ED symptoms.

How Vidalista 40 Works?

From a physiological perspective, Vidalista 40 works by blocking the degradation of cyclic guanosine monophosphate (cGMP) via the inhibition of PDE5. This allows cGMP to accumulate, resulting in smooth muscle relaxation and vasodilation of penile arteries. This pharmacological effect enables a stronger and longer-lasting erection when sexual arousal is present. Its effects can last up to 36 hours, hence it’s sometimes referred to as “the weekend pill.”

How to Use Vidalista 40

Vidalista 40 should be taken orally with water, approximately 30 to 60 minutes before planned sexual activity. It should not be taken more than once per 24 hours. Taking it with or without food is acceptable, although fatty meals might delay its onset. Alcohol should be avoided or minimized, as it can increase the risk of side effects and reduce the drug’s efficacy.

Side Effects of Vidalista 40

The most commonly reported side effects include headache, facial flushing, nasal congestion, muscle pain, and indigestion. These are generally mild and self-limiting. More serious but rare side effects can include prolonged erections (priapism), vision changes, hearing loss, and significant drops in blood pressure. If any of these occur, the patient must seek immediate medical help. Adverse effects are dose-dependent, and 40 mg is considered a relatively high dose.

Interactions and Contraindications

Tadalafil can interact with nitrates (used for chest pain), alpha-blockers (used for blood pressure or prostate issues), antifungals, certain antibiotics, and antiviral drugs. These interactions can lead to severe hypotension or cardiovascular instability. Vidalista 40 should not be taken alongside other ED treatments or recreational drugs containing nitrates, such as amyl nitrite (commonly known as poppers). A full medical history and medication list must be reviewed before starting treatment.

Vidalista 40 vs. Other ED Medications

Compared to Sildenafil (Viagra) or Vardenafil (Levitra), Tadalafil (Vidalista’s active component) has a longer half-life (17.5 hours), allowing for extended effectiveness. While Sildenafil acts for about 4–6 hours, Vidalista 40 provides benefits for up to 36 hours. This means patients may enjoy greater spontaneity, but it also increases the importance of being aware of side effects over a longer duration.
